Wow is it actual glass? Or some type of polycarbonate plexiglass?

How do you adhere it to the plenum?


Edit: Found a video on Youtube that shows how to do it, and parts list…

Is the same procedure you followed?
Yea, E6000 glue and 1/32 Lexan polycarbonate glass does the trick. You can always use plastic rivets for extra strength.
